Output 673fc4d594a1fea8a4183b3e8cafeb46aae3f1ead9cf23aedc604e8650840c99:1

value
18978425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ad342e762d456813f67887296f17fe36800fbd46 OP_EQUAL
address
MPgyeFUZTxxjVwLbmdbjQzjELSrCtbQ8WT
transaction
673fc4d594a1fea8a4183b3e8cafeb46aae3f1ead9cf23aedc604e8650840c99
spent
true